Lt. Col. Dor Ben Simhon, killed overnight in southern Lebanon, was the fourth commander of the 52nd Battalion hit in combat since the war began; the 401st Armored Brigade also lost its commander in Gaza, while his replacement was seriously wounded last month

The military revealed that one of the soldiers was Lieutenant-Colonel Dor Gedalia Ben Simhon, aged 32, from Beit HaShita, the commander of the 52nd Battalion, 401st Brigade.
